Bug Description
If i use kpowersave along with notify-osd in Jaunty,one keystroke for lowering brightness is interpreted as two and brightness reduces by two levels,without kpowersave it works fine.
Ubuntu 9.04 x64

KPowersave has been removed from distribution in both Ubuntu and Debian since:
- The package no longer builds, leaving us with no way to provide further updates
- Its author(s) no longer update KPowersave
- Its functionality is largely replaced in KDE4 by PowerDevil.
Unfortunately this means we will not be able to provide further bugfixes or updates to this package. Thanks for understanding.
